Abstract

The article is devoted to problems of simulation an electromagnetic field distribution near high-voltage power equipment. A radiating model of the power autotransformer 500 kV is presented. This model includes sizes and relative positioning of the autotransformer’s case and radiating elements, different constructions and earth existence, materials properties. The elements and constructions, located near the high-voltage equipment, such as cooling radiators, wireline passes, additions to lead-in wires, auxiliary columns, support for bus wire fastening, fire extinguisher system, concrete partitions are considered. Models of an electrical power object which contains above-mentioned elements and constructions are developed. The models are used for calculation electromagnetic field distribution on the electrical power object. Pictures of electromagnetic field distribution on a real electrical power object are calculated and presented in the form of direction patterns. Influence of the separate elements and constructions on the form of the directional pattern of the electrical power object model is estimated both in a form and in absolute values of electric-field strength of vertical polarization. The results achieved might be used at diagnostics of the high-voltage power equipment by electromagnetic control method.
